Connolly's Maiden Ton

Connolly defied cramps to play the innings of his life at the Sher-e-Bangla National Stadium on Sunday, smashing 149 off 133 balls as Australia narrowly avoided a whitewash by edging past Bangladesh’s five for 274 with three deliveries to spare.

The Data Analysis

  • Connolly hit 13 fours and six sixes in his innings.
  • He raised a masterful century off 87 deliveries.
  • The young West Australian’s previous highest score was 61 not out in ODIs and 64 in all List-A games.

Australia made the perfect start when Soumya (two) was bowled by Bartlett (two for 47) in the first over. However, Bangladesh appeared to be in control thanks to half-centuries from Towhid Hridoy (83), Litton Das (58 not out) and Mosaddek Hossain (56 not out).
